How to Choose the Right Electrical Contractor for Your Project

Maraj Electric

Choosing the right electrical contractor is a crucial step in ensuring the success, safety, and efficiency of any electrical project. Whether you are planning a home renovation, building a new property, or handling a commercial installation, the contractor you hire can make a significant difference in the outcome. With many options available, knowing what to look for can help you make a confident and informed decision.

One of the first things to consider is licensing and certification. A qualified electrical contractor should hold the necessary licenses required by local authorities. This ensures they have the proper training and knowledge to perform electrical work safely and according to regulations. Hiring a licensed professional not only protects your property but also reduces the risk of legal and safety issues.

Experience is another important factor. Electrical work can vary greatly depending on the type of project, so it is essential to choose a contractor with relevant experience. For example, residential projects differ from commercial or industrial work in terms of complexity and requirements. An experienced contractor will be better equipped to handle challenges, provide practical solutions, and deliver high-quality results.

Reputation and reviews also play a key role in the selection process. Look for contractors with positive customer feedback and a strong track record. Online reviews, testimonials, and word-of-mouth recommendations can provide valuable insights into a contractor’s reliability, professionalism, and work quality. A reputable contractor is more likely to complete the project on time and maintain clear communication throughout.

It is also important to request detailed estimates before making a decision. A professional electrical contractor should provide a clear and transparent quote that outlines the cost of materials, labor, and any additional charges. Avoid contractors who give vague estimates or significantly lower prices than others, as this could indicate poor quality work or hidden costs later on.

Insurance coverage is another critical aspect to check. A reliable contractor should have both liability insurance and worker’s compensation coverage. This protects you from being held responsible in case of accidents, injuries, or property damage during the project. Always verify insurance details before signing any agreement.

Communication and professionalism should not be overlooked. A good contractor listens to your needs, answers your questions clearly, and keeps you updated on the project’s progress. Clear communication helps avoid misunderstandings and ensures that your expectations are met.

Finally, always ask for references or examples of previous work. Seeing completed projects or speaking with past clients can give you a better understanding of the contractor’s capabilities and work standards.

In conclusion, choosing the right electrical contractor requires careful consideration of qualifications, experience, reputation, and professionalism. Taking the time to evaluate your options can help you avoid costly mistakes and ensure your project is completed safely and efficiently. 

Safety First: Best Practices for Electrical Work in Large-Scale Industrial Projects

Maraj Electric

Electrical work is one of the most critical components of large-scale industrial projects. From manufacturing plants and transportation facilities to large infrastructure developments, electrical systems power essential operations and ensure that equipment, machinery, and facilities function efficiently. However, the complexity and scale of industrial electrical installations also introduce significant safety risks. Implementing strict safety practices is therefore essential to protect workers, ensure regulatory compliance, and maintain project efficiency.

Comprehensive Planning and Risk Assessment

Safety in industrial electrical work begins long before installation starts. Comprehensive planning and detailed risk assessments are essential steps in identifying potential hazards associated with electrical systems, equipment, and construction environments. Project managers and electrical engineers must carefully evaluate site conditions, voltage requirements, equipment specifications, and environmental factors.

A thorough risk assessment helps determine potential safety challenges such as high-voltage exposure, confined workspaces, or coordination with other construction activities. By identifying these risks early, teams can implement preventative measures and develop safety procedures that minimize accidents and disruptions during the project lifecycle.

Compliance with Industry Standards and Regulations

Large-scale electrical projects must strictly comply with national and regional electrical codes, safety standards, and regulatory requirements. These guidelines ensure that installations meet recognized safety benchmarks and operate reliably over the long term.

Licensed electricians and certified contractors are responsible for adhering to these standards throughout the project. Regular inspections, documentation, and quality checks help ensure that all electrical components are installed correctly and safely. Compliance not only protects workers and the public but also prevents costly delays, penalties, or system failures after project completion.

Proper Training and Skilled Workforce

A well-trained workforce is one of the most important factors in maintaining safety on industrial electrical projects. Workers must have a deep understanding of electrical systems, safety protocols, and proper equipment handling. Continuous training programs allow teams to stay updated on evolving technologies, safety practices, and regulatory changes.

In addition to technical expertise, workers must also be trained to recognize hazards, respond to emergencies, and follow established safety procedures. Supervisors and project leaders play a key role in reinforcing these standards and ensuring that every team member prioritizes safety during daily operations.

Use of Protective Equipment and Safety Technology

Personal protective equipment (PPE) is essential for minimizing risks associated with electrical work. Insulated gloves, safety helmets, protective clothing, and specialized tools help safeguard workers from electrical shocks, arc flashes, and other hazards.

Modern industrial projects also benefit from advanced safety technologies such as arc flash protection systems, automated circuit monitoring, and real-time safety diagnostics. These innovations allow teams to detect potential issues early and respond quickly to prevent accidents.

Conclusion

Safety must always remain the top priority in large-scale industrial electrical projects. Through careful planning, strict regulatory compliance, skilled workforce training, and the use of modern safety technologies, contractors can significantly reduce risks and create a safer working environment. By adopting these best practices, industrial projects can achieve both operational efficiency and long-term reliability while protecting the people who bring these complex systems to life.

Common Electrical Problems in Homes and How Professionals Fix Them

Maraj Electric

Electrical issues are a common concern in many households, and while some may seem minor, they can quickly turn into serious safety hazards if left unaddressed. Understanding these problems and how professionals handle them can help homeowners take timely action and maintain a safe living environment.

One of the most frequent issues is flickering or dimming lights. This problem is often caused by loose wiring, overloaded circuits, or faulty light fixtures. While it may appear harmless at first, it can indicate deeper electrical faults. Professional electricians typically inspect the wiring connections, check the load on the circuit, and replace any defective components to restore consistent lighting.

Another common problem is frequent circuit breaker tripping. Circuit breakers are designed to protect your home by shutting off power when there is an overload or short circuit. However, if they trip regularly, it may signal that your electrical system is under strain. Electricians usually diagnose the root cause by testing the circuit load, identifying faulty appliances, and, if necessary, upgrading the electrical panel to handle increased demand.

Dead outlets are also a widespread issue in homes. An outlet may stop working due to tripped breakers, damaged wiring, or internal faults. While resetting the breaker might solve the issue temporarily, recurring problems require professional attention. Electricians use specialized tools to trace the wiring, identify faults, and repair or replace the outlet safely.

Outdated or faulty wiring is another major concern, especially in older homes. Aging wiring systems may not meet modern electrical demands and can increase the risk of electrical fires. Professionals often recommend rewiring parts of the home or upgrading the entire system to meet current safety standards. This process not only improves safety but also enhances overall efficiency.

Electrical surges are another issue that homeowners may experience. These sudden spikes in voltage can damage appliances and reduce their lifespan. Surges are often caused by lightning, faulty wiring, or issues with the power grid. Electricians typically install surge protectors and inspect the system to prevent future occurrences.

Lastly, warm or sparking outlets should never be ignored. These are clear warning signs of serious electrical problems, such as loose connections or short circuits. A professional electrician will immediately shut off power to the affected area, inspect the outlet, and make the necessary repairs to eliminate the risk of fire or electric shock.

In conclusion, while some electrical problems may seem minor, they often point to larger underlying issues. Attempting to fix them without proper knowledge can be dangerous. Hiring a qualified electrician ensures that problems are diagnosed accurately and resolved safely, giving homeowners peace of mind and a more reliable electrical system. 

Top Mistakes to Avoid in Electrical Installations

Maraj Electric

Electrical installations require precision, planning, and strict adherence to safety standards. Even small mistakes can lead to serious consequences such as electrical fires, equipment damage, or personal injury. Whether it’s a residential or commercial project, avoiding common errors is essential for ensuring a safe and efficient electrical system.

One of the most common mistakes is improper planning. Many installations begin without a clear understanding of the electrical load requirements. This can result in overloaded circuits, frequent breaker trips, and reduced system performance. Proper planning involves calculating the expected load, designing circuits accordingly, and ensuring the system can handle future expansions.

Another major error is using the wrong type or size of wiring. Each electrical application requires specific wire sizes and materials to safely carry the current. Using undersized wires can lead to overheating and increase the risk of fire, while oversized wires may be unnecessarily costly and difficult to manage. Professional electricians carefully select the appropriate wiring based on the project’s requirements and safety codes.

Poor connections are also a frequent issue in electrical installations. Loose or improperly secured connections can cause power fluctuations, overheating, and even sparks. These problems may not be immediately visible but can worsen over time. Ensuring tight, secure, and properly insulated connections is essential for maintaining system reliability.

Ignoring grounding and bonding is another critical mistake. Grounding provides a safe path for excess electricity to flow in case of a fault, reducing the risk of electric shock. Without proper grounding, electrical systems become significantly more dangerous. Professionals always ensure that grounding systems are correctly installed and meet regulatory standards.

Overlooking safety devices is another problem that can compromise an installation. Circuit breakers, fuses, and surge protectors are designed to protect both the system and its users. Skipping or improperly installing these devices can leave the system vulnerable to damage and increase safety risks. A well-designed system includes all necessary protective components.

Many people also make the mistake of attempting DIY electrical work without proper knowledge or training. While it may seem cost-effective, unqualified work often leads to serious issues that are expensive to fix later. Hiring a licensed professional ensures that installations are completed safely and in compliance with local codes.

Another overlooked mistake is failing to test the system after installation. Testing helps identify hidden faults, verify proper functioning, and ensure everything is operating as intended. Skipping this step can leave undetected issues that may cause problems in the future.

In conclusion, electrical installation mistakes can have serious and costly consequences. By focusing on proper planning, using the right materials, ensuring secure connections, and following safety standards, these errors can be avoided. When in doubt, relying on experienced professionals is always the best approach to ensure a safe and long-lasting electrical system.

Why Heavy Industrial Electrical Installations Demand Specialized Expertise

Maraj Electric

Heavy industrial facilities rely on powerful and complex electrical systems to operate critical machinery, control production processes, and maintain safety across large-scale operations. Unlike standard commercial or residential projects, industrial electrical installations involve high-voltage equipment, advanced control systems, and strict regulatory requirements. Because of these complexities, specialized expertise is essential to ensure safe, efficient, and reliable performance.

Understanding the Complexity of Industrial Systems

Industrial electrical systems are far more intricate than typical building installations. They often include high-voltage switchgear, transformers, motor control centers, automation panels, and integrated control networks such as SCADA systems. These components must work together seamlessly to support continuous operations. A small error in design or installation can lead to costly downtime, equipment damage, or serious safety risks.

Managing High Voltage and Safety Risks

High-voltage environments pose significant dangers if not handled correctly. Industrial electricians must follow strict safety protocols, including proper grounding, lockout/tagout procedures, arc-flash protection, and personal protective equipment standards. Specialized training allows professionals to identify hazards, minimize risks, and maintain safe working conditions for all personnel. This level of safety awareness is critical in preventing accidents and ensuring compliance with industry regulations.

Ensuring Regulatory Compliance

Industrial projects must comply with local, state, and federal electrical codes, as well as industry-specific regulations. These standards are often more demanding than those for commercial projects. Specialized contractors understand how to navigate compliance requirements, perform necessary inspections, and maintain accurate documentation. Their expertise ensures that installations pass regulatory reviews and operate within legal and safety guidelines.

Integrating Advanced Technologies

Modern industrial facilities depend on automation, monitoring, and data-driven systems. Specialized electrical professionals are trained to install and integrate technologies such as programmable logic controllers (PLCs), industrial networks, smart sensors, and remote monitoring systems. These tools improve efficiency, reduce human error, and allow operators to detect problems before they become major failures.

Reducing Downtime and Improving Reliability

Every minute of downtime in an industrial facility can result in significant financial losses. Specialized electrical contractors design systems that are reliable, scalable, and easy to maintain. Through predictive maintenance strategies and real-time monitoring, they help prevent unexpected breakdowns and extend the lifespan of critical equipment.

Conclusion

Heavy industrial electrical installations demand specialized expertise because of their complexity, safety requirements, and operational impact. Skilled professionals bring the technical knowledge, regulatory awareness, and problem-solving ability needed to manage these challenging environments. Their expertise not only protects workers and equipment but also ensures that industrial operations run smoothly, efficiently, and safely. 

The Importance of Licensed and Bonded Contractors in Government Projects

Maraj Electric

Government projects play a vital role in building and maintaining public infrastructure, from schools and hospitals to transportation systems and utilities. Because these projects involve public funds and impact community safety, strict standards must be followed. This is why working with licensed and bonded contractors is essential. These qualifications protect taxpayers, ensure compliance, and help deliver high-quality results.

What It Means to Be Licensed and Bonded

A licensed contractor has met all legal and professional requirements set by local and state authorities. This includes passing exams, demonstrating technical competence, and complying with safety and building codes. A bonded contractor, on the other hand, has secured a financial guarantee through a surety bond. This bond protects the government agency if the contractor fails to complete the project or meet contractual obligations.

Protecting Public Funds and Reducing Risk

Government projects are funded by taxpayers, making financial accountability a top priority. Licensed and bonded contractors provide an extra layer of security by ensuring that projects are completed as agreed. If problems arise, the bond helps cover financial losses. This reduces risk for government agencies and builds trust between contractors and public institutions.

Ensuring Compliance With Regulations

Government construction and infrastructure projects must follow strict laws, safety standards, and environmental regulations. Licensed contractors are trained to understand and apply these requirements. Their knowledge helps prevent legal issues, delays, and costly corrections. Compliance also ensures that completed projects are safe, reliable, and suitable for public use.

Promoting Professionalism and Quality Work

Licensed and bonded contractors are held to higher professional standards. They are required to maintain insurance, follow ethical business practices, and deliver quality workmanship. This level of accountability encourages contractors to perform at their best and ensures that government projects meet long-term performance and safety expectations.

Supporting Transparency and Public Trust

Transparency is essential in public-sector projects. Working with licensed and bonded contractors helps maintain accountability and clear documentation throughout the project lifecycle. This promotes public confidence in how government funds are managed and how infrastructure is developed.

Conclusion

Licensed and bonded contractors play a crucial role in the success of government projects. Their qualifications protect public resources, ensure regulatory compliance, and deliver reliable, high-quality results. By choosing qualified professionals, government agencies can reduce risk, improve project outcomes, and strengthen public trust in infrastructure development.
